India on Tuesday evacuated all its staff from its embassy in the Yemeni capital of Sanaa, days after wrapping up a massive rescue operation under which over 4,700 Indians were brought home from the war-ravaged country.

"We have evacuated our embassy staff from Yemen today," External Affairs Minister Sushma Swaraj said .India had closed down the embassy in Sanaa on April 9 after winding up the air evacuation. India had also evacuated nearly 1,000 foreign citizens from 41 countries.
